Maintenance Operator (1 year contract)

Walker Environmental

Walker Environmental, a division of Walker Industries, is a leading resource recovery and waste management company. The company owns and operates landfills, waste transfer and haulage facilities, Biosolids processing plants, composting facilities, food/residual organic processing facilities and landfill gas renewable energy projects throughout Canada. Our product brands, created from the recovery of resources often considered waste, include N-Rich®, All Treat Farms® and Gro-Bark®.

Maintenance Operator

Today, we have an opening for a Maintenance Operator at our Halifax Biosolids plant on a temporary (1) year contract.

Our philosophy to biosolids management is simple – complete the cycle. We recover the valuable resources contained in this “waste” and return them to the earth where they belong.

The high standard of our services, technology, and environmental stewardship sets us apart from others in the industry – and has created fast-paced growth across Canada.


Responsibilities:

  • Compliance monitoring;
  • Daily data entry;
  • Operate and maintain process equipment;
  • Ensure all regular/preventative maintenance is performed and documented;
  • Maintain inventory of tools, replacement parts and supplies;
  • Document daily processing parameters.
  • Maintain plant cleanliness and organization.

Requirements:

  • Grade 12 graduate with some post-secondary training preferred. Post-secondary students in engineering/technology, skilled trades, environmental science or other related fields will also be considered.
  • Strong communication skills both verbal and written
  • Heavy Equipment experience preferred– (i.e. wheel loader)
  • Work in a rotating shift schedule with evenings and weekend work
  • Be able to work alone occasionally
  • Ability to work in small teams
  • Have a mechanical aptitude to troubleshoot process and equipment issues.
  • Perform light preventative maintenance duties and support Lead Hand with larger repairs.
  • Familiarity with analytical sampling methods for environmental compliance monitoring.
  • Required to be clean shaven for occasional respirator use.
